Barbara Corcoran is issuing a heartfelt apology in the direction of Whoopi Goldberg after fielding criticism for making what she called a "joke" about the "Sister Act" star on "The View" Thursday. "I just came back from ‘The View’ and saw my old friend Whoopi," the "Shark Tank" star, 72, began in a video shared to Twitter. "She has a phenomenal sense of humor, and I've known Whoopi for years." Corcoran continued: "I made a joke at Whoopi's expense, which I now realize wasn't funny.

Even a woman as business savvy as Barbara Corcoran can have the wool pulled over her eyes. The star recently revealed that she was scammed out of nearly $400,000 but confirms that she was thankfully able to get the money back.
